Abstract
The Dongting Lake is the important flood storage place of the Changjiang River,Xiang River,Zi River,Yuan River and Li River,which plays an important role in the flood control of the middle and lower Changjiang River. Because of sediment disposition,reclamation,change of river-lake relation,the flood storage function of the Dongting Lake has changed a lot. According to the different times of flood storage function during 1954 to 2010 and the process of extreme flood storage in 1954 and in 1998,the article researches on characteristics of flood storage and change law of the Dongting Lake,which is of reference for compiling flood control general plan of the middle and lower Changjiang River,especially of the Dongting Lake.
